Tune In Alert: Sara Evans To Guest Cohost On “The Talk” November 13th

Multi-platinum entertainer Sara Evans will guest cohost on “The Talk” next week, joining hosts Sara Gilbert, Sharon Osbourne, Sheryl Underwood, and Eve for the live talk show airing Tuesday, November 13th at 2:00 pm ET / 1:00 pm CT on CBS.

The appearance takes place weeks before the return of Evans’ popular, limited-engagement “At Christmas Tour,” with festive shows created to get fans of all ages into the spirit of the season. The tour kicks off November 24th in Cincinnati, Ohio with special guests Fairground Saints.

Sara continues to forge a bold, creative path with the launch of Born To Fly Records, distributed by Sony RED, and her highly anticipated eighth studio album, “Words”, which debuted at #2 on Billboard’s Top Country Albums Chart. The project has been dubbed the album of her lifetime that “captures an artist in full musical flight” (Associated Press) and was named among Billboard and Rolling Stone’s favorite country albums of 2017.

In addition to a prolific country music career, Sara has been honored for her philanthropic work and in 2018 was presented the NAB Education Foundation’s Service To America Leadership Award. A Red Cross ambassador, Sara received the national Crystal Cross award for her work with the disaster-relief organization and recently raised more than $10,000 for CMA Foundation and music education from the sale of her ONEHope Sara Evans Signature Series 2014 Napa Valley Cabernet Sauvignon.
